Read moreJust book this one. This is a FANTASTIC property. It has every box checked. We actually decided to stay in rexburg rather than Idaho falls while passing through because this hotel was the best value and had all of our criteria met.
The service: friendly young lady greeted us and checked us in, there was always someone at the front desk or nearby as soon as anyone walked by. There was never any wait if you needed anything.
The location: not downtown but not a far drive, restaurants on site, another hotel nearby, close to the highway if you’re just passing through. The view from the window is farmland and it’s a nice thing to wake up to.
The room: the room was very large (not sure if we were given a family suite, but possible). It was clean, the bed and sheets were very comfortable and soft linens are a nice touch compared to similarly priced hotels.
The amenities: the pool is a decent size, not overly large, no hot tub but temperature is warm for the pool. There is a nice outdoor sun area as well. The hotel has two EV charging stations that are complimentary use for guests. (One in the front and one on the side - and 6kw chatting which is more than good for a full overnight charge)
The breakfast: the breakfast was very nice. The baked selection was good, nice yogurts, good coffee, teas, and hot items as well.
Note: I really loved the board games they had in the front lounge area. That’s a very nice touch!
10/10 would return to this hotel.
